**Alert: Stormcry fan-out lag exceeding threshold**

This one fires when the Stormcry weather-alert fan-out falls more than 90 seconds behind ingest. From a security standpoint, the interesting bit is that delayed delivery can cause signed alert tokens to expire before they reach subscribers, which then triggers re-signing with elevated service credentials. Worth a close look at that path. The signing flow and mitigation notes live on the internal page below.

operations page: https://jenkins.zemvarcloud.local/job/merge_requests/repo/build/73930b4b30f0a8ed

Handover note — Crumbwheel order cutoffs.

Welcome aboard. The bakery cutoff rule in Crumbwheel closes same-day orders at 14:00 local to each storefront, not UTC — this has bitten us twice. Holiday overrides live in the calendar service and take precedence silently, so always check there first when a cutoff looks wrong. To unlock the calendar service's admin console after a restart, enter the recovery passphrase below.

vault phrase of bagap-bahaf = silion-pelox-sorox-casdor-quenwyn-fraax-eliox-praael-kelion-quenvan-kasox-rusael-norius-belvan

### Step 2: Enable dual-write mode

Before running the Ledgerline schema migration, switch the service into dual-write mode so both old and new tables stay consistent. Traffic continues uninterrupted; the backfill job reconciles historical rows in the background. Do not proceed to cut-over until lag reaches zero. Apply the settings below to each node.

settings of fafog-haduf:
ZORIX_PIN=4648
ZORIX_METRICS_HOST=metrics.zorix.paliqsys.corp
ZORIX_LOG_LEVEL=info
ZORIX_TENANT=druix

- [ ] Step 7: Archive cold storage buckets (Glacierline tier). Confirm both ceremony witnesses are present, verify bucket manifests match the Oxbow ledger, then seal the archive key shares. Plugin authors may observe but not handle shares. Once sealed, the archive index itself is encrypted and can only be reopened with the passphrase below.

vault phrase of badup-hahig = tamael-aldael-kelmir-istael-fenok-istwyn-tamius-jorath-oliion